Emissions on agricultural land — Emissions Share in Sweden
Sweden: Emissions on agricultural land — Emissions Share was 46.54 % in 2023. ◆ Volatile
Emissions on agricultural land — Emissions Share in Sweden, 1990–2023
Source: Food and Agriculture Organization of the United Nations. Measured in %.
Analysis
In 2023, emissions on agricultural land — emissions share in Sweden stood at 46.54 %.
That represents a change of up 2.6% on the previous year and down 63.3% over ten years.
Over the whole period, emissions on agricultural land — emissions share in Sweden peaked at 283.42 % in 2015 and was at its lowest, 34.88 %, in 2002.
That places Sweden 41st out of 192 countries with data for 2023, putting it in the top quarter.
The series is highly variable year to year, so single readings are best treated with caution.

About this data
The FAOSTAT domain on Emissions indicators disseminates indicators on sectoral shares of total national greenhouse gas (GHG) emissions as well as three indicators of emissions intensity: per capita emissions; emissions per value of agricultural production; and emissions per area of agricultural land.
